Kwara ADC Unveils Retired Educationist Julius Olawuyi as Zakari Mohammed's Running Mate

Date: 2026-07-22

The African Democratic Congress (ADC) has unveiled Elder Olawuyi Julius Olayide, a retired teacher and school administrator, as the running mate to its governorship candidate in Kwara State, Rt. Hon. Zakari Mohammed, ahead of the forthcoming governorship election.

Zakari announced the selection on his official Facebook page on Monday, introducing Olawuyi as a seasoned educationist from Offa in Offa Local Government Area of the state.

"I have the pleasure to present my running mate, Elder Julius Olaide Olawuyi, a retired teacher and school administrator from Offa town, in Offa Local Government Area of Kwara State. ADC, Arise and Shine Nigeria," he wrote.

Born on January 20, 1960, in Offa, Elder Olawuyi is an experienced educationist with more than three decades of service in teaching and school administration. He is married with children and is widely recognised for his contributions to education, community development and grassroots leadership.

He earned a Nigeria Certificate in Education (NCE) in Economics/Social Studies from the College of Education, Oro, in 1984 before obtaining a Bachelor of Arts in Education (B.A.Ed.) in Social Studies from the University of Ilorin in 1991.

During his 34-year teaching career, he served at Ansar-Ud-Deen College, Offa (1986-2005), Offa Community Secondary School (2005-2006) and Nawar-Ud-Deen College (2006-2011).

He later became Vice Principal of Moremi High School, Offa, where he served from 2011 until his retirement on January 20, 2020.

The ADC described Olawuyi as a man of integrity, humility and wisdom, expressing confidence that his wealth of experience in education and administration would strengthen the party's governorship ticket.

According to the party, the Zakari Mohammed-Olawuyi ticket is committed to delivering people-centred leadership focused on improving education, empowering youths and women, strengthening the economy and driving sustainable development across Kwara State.

The unveiling marks another milestone in the ADC's preparations for the governorship election as the party positions itself as an alternative political platform for the people of Kwara State.
